The primary way to achieve "auto-aim" in PUBG Mobile is through the legitimate Aim Assist feature. Using third-party "verified config files" or scripts is a violation of the PUBG Mobile Terms of Service and can lead to a permanent ban. 🎯 Official Aim Assist Activation

The standard in-game aim assist helps your crosshair track enemies and stay on target during gunfights.

Open Settings: Tap the small arrow in the bottom right of the lobby.

Navigate to Controls: Select Controls and then tap the Advanced Controls tab at the top. auto aim config pubg mobile verified

Enable Feature: Scroll down to the Assist Features section and toggle Aim Assist to Enabled.

Performance Note: Aim assist is most effective in TPP (Third Person Perspective) Classic mode and training grounds. ⚙️ Pro-Level Sensitivity Optimization

    Using "auto aim config" files in PUBG Mobile is a violation of the game's Rules of Conduct and will likely result in a permanent 10-year ban. The official Ban Pan 2.0 security system actively detects unauthorized game file modifications (like .ini or Active.sav edits).

    Instead of using risky external files, the most effective and safe way to improve your aim is by optimizing in-game settings and using legitimate "aim assist" features. ⚡ Legitimate "Auto Aim" (Aim Assist)

    PUBG Mobile includes a built-in "Aim Assist" feature that helps your crosshair stick to targets without risk of a ban. How to Enable: Open Settings from the main menu. Tap on the Controls tab. Select Advanced Controls. Scroll down to Assist Features. Toggle Aim Assist to Enabled.

    💡 Note: Aim assist is strongest in close-range hip-fire and slightly pulls your aim toward the enemy's chest. 🎯 Pro-Level Sensitivity Settings (2026) Gyroscope "Soft Aim" Trick (Elite players use this)
